Jeff Allen lands a coveted position at Wolfe Brothers, a high‑end Manhattan brokerage where charismatic, cut‑throat stockbrokers thrive on ruthless ambition. He soon discovers their edge is an animalistic instinct that is gradually turning him into a werewolf, leaving him to wonder if he can escape the predatory world before it consumes him.

On the advice of a bartender familiar with the Wall Street crowd, Jeff Allen, [William Gregory Lee], applies to the Wolfe Brothers brokerage firm in New York City for his dream job as a stock broker. What he does not know is that the brokers are werewolves, and he is bitten, thus he joins the pack. He is forced to abandon his love and values for cunning and instinct during which time he cheats on his girlfriend, Annabella Morris, [Elisa Donovan], and brutally kills and eats various humans. After a change of heart, he finds that leaving the brotherhood is harder than joining.

Jeff goes to Annabella’s friend’s birthday party, where a drunk man tries hitting on her. In a brutal moment, Jeff rips a piece out of the drunk’s neck and then chases his girlfriend back to her apartment, biting her and transforming her into a werewolf as well.

Annabella had given him a silver pen when he first started as an intern at the Wolfe Brothers firm, and he goes back to the headquarters to quit, but his mentor, Dyson Keller, [Eric Roberts], refuses to let him go. Jeff leaves anyway, but the werewolves, led by Vince, [Michael Bergin], go to Annabella’s apartment and seize her. They force him to return to headquarters, and he stabs the person he thought was the alpha, but he is wrong, and a fight ensues during which he and his girlfriend kill all of the werewolves, and then they start walking away.

The-alphas survive, opening their eyes a split second before the end of the film, signaling that the battle—though costly—was not truly over and that the pack’s dark secret remains very much alive.
